I posted this in my online Music Appreciation class just this morning, to a message entitled “Roll Over, Beethoven,” not knowing this would happen today:

“The subject reference is to a 1956 R&B song by Chuck Berry (https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=jLD5H4uQ1xs). It was supposedly written because Chuck had a continuing battle with his sister Lucy (who became Lucy Williams), who wanted to play classical music on the family’s piano while Chuck wanted to play what became rock-n-roll on his guitar: the “pull quote” from the lyrics is, “roll over Beethoven and tell Tchaikovsky the news,” referring to Beethoven rolling over in his grave to hear the new music. It is, I think, the perfect metaphorical illustration of what I wrote about in another message, that in the 1950s the guitar overtakes the piano as the defining musical instrument.”

Roll over Beethoven, make some room for Chuck. RIP.
